Watch: Man crashes car after ‘shockingly dangerous’ drive through York

A video of a man’s ‘shockingly dangerous’ drive through York has been released after he was sentenced in court.

Scott Anthony Bone, 37, crashed off the road after leading police on a high-speed 15-minute chase.

He failed to stop for police while driving a black Seat Ibiza on Water Lane in the early hours of 9 October 2024 – Bone’s birthday.

That sparked a chase in which he drove well in excess of the speed limit, went through a red light and turned off his car’s lights on unlit sections of road.

The pursuit went took him onto the outer ring road, into Sutton-on-the-Forest and along country lanes towards Strensall.

He then crashed into a field on the outskirts of York.

Bone, who’s from of Ingram Avenue, Clifton, ran from the vehicle, but was soon apprehended and arrested

In custody, he failed to provide a specimen of breath for analysis, and was found to be in possession of pregabalin tablets that hadn’t been prescribed to him.

Bone pleaded guilty to dangerous driving, possessing a class C drug, failing to provide a specimen of breath, and obstructing police.

At York Crown Court today, he was given a 12 month prison sentence, suspended for 18 months.

He was ordered to undertake drug and alcohol rehabilitation treatment, and carry out unpaid work for 280 hours. He was also disqualified from driving for 18 months, and must pay costs and a surcharge totalling £387.

North Yorkshire Police said they won’t tolerate such “shockingly dangerous driving” through York”.

Traffic Sergeant Ryan Lyth, of the roads policing group, said: “Bone’s behaviour was totally unacceptable – we will continue to target and pursue offenders like him who cause a danger on our roads.”
